Transaction 699c93153e4e76128cf1c6c23a951729fc1454b29e1e084e372a524c260cb9ac
1 Input
1 Output
-
699c93153e4e76128cf1c6c23a951729fc1454b29e1e084e372a524c260cb9ac:0
- value
- 10829145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32f178928cca5b996ad1fe495e132714c084bd46 OP_EQUAL
- address
- MCYXHiiCjatbavZeGpZY5pnVS7X7Ydu8qj